Output 98c25b656d4d3849f80ed46822425cd6707c0b779b125682f5f160e736f6e1a6:1

value
1660235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56e0649c72c50a683db8fd9ffed94ac8eb664385 OP_EQUAL
address
39cNr98YFPtCNDmuHAgUAqR9VEpGg4xxDQ
transaction
98c25b656d4d3849f80ed46822425cd6707c0b779b125682f5f160e736f6e1a6
confirmations
268398
spent
true